MOMENT: Devices

We brought a folding chair to help Tavish with his skating. First, we offered him the back of the chair. He didn't move very far. We gave him the seat, it moved better, but was still unsatisfactory. The stroller seemed more promising, but Tavish eventually just stopped altogether. Hmm... so, we offered the chair again. "No, I think I'll just skate." And, he did. That was the last for the chair and our next time out - he was given a whole new device to skate with: a hockey stick!
